Gibt es die Möglichkeit vba in Excel so zu programmieren, dass verschobene Spalten (durch einfügen neuer spalten davor) in Vba berücksichtigt werden
Ein Beispiel:
Anfangs war es so:
Ein Vba code greift auf die Zelle A2 mittels ActiveSheet.Cells(i,1 ) zu.
Dann wird aber eine Spalte vor A eingefügt und plötzlich heißt es:
|
A |
B |
1 |
Datum |
Betrag |
2 |
1.1.2024 |
12€ |
Dieses Problem habe ich immer wieder und es sind ca. 5 Markos die auf die Informationen zur Formatierung, Rechnung und Zahlungsbestätigung generieren und so weiter zu greifen. Könnte ich den code so verändern dass er die veränderungen automatisch mit macht. Müsste ich nicht in allen Markos nach allen bezügen suchen . Kennt da jemand einen Weg?
|